Q: Is 106,533 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 106,533 is a composite number.

Why is 106,533 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 106,533 can be evenly divided by 1 3 7 9 19 21 57 63 89 133 171 267 399 623 801 1,197 1,691 1,869 5,073 5,607 11,837 15,219 35,511 and 106,533, with no remainder.

Since 106,533 cannot be divided by just 1 and 106,533, it is a composite number.
